Kilmarnock FC & Show Racism the Red Card Stadium Event , March 20th 2009

Kilmarnock Football Club  hosted a major Show Racism the Red Card (SRTRC) seminar for 100 local primary school children at Rugby Park on Wednesday 11th March 2009.  Schools included Hillhead Primary, Onthank Primary, Mount Carmel Primary and Gargieston Primary.  The anti-racist seminar included a Q&A session followed by a screening of the Show Racism the Red Card DVD. The young people got the chance to question a panel of experts including Craig Bryson and Kevin Kyle about racism and its consequences.

Young people attending the seminar were provided with a bag of goodies including posters and magazines.

Killie Chairman Michael Johnston stated, "Kilmarnock Football Club is delighted to support this initiative and fully endorses its objectives. It is vital to get the message across to children at an early age that racial integration is essential for a healthy society in which everyone can prosper and enjoy equal treatment".

Billy Singh, Campaign Coordinator for Show Racism the Red Card in Scotland, said, "Show Racism the Red Card are extremely pleased to be working with Kilmarnock Football Club on this kind of event. The impact on the young people of meeting and listening to players in this setting is considerable. In our experience these kinds of events are very positive and leave a lasting anti-racist message with young people. We very much look forward to what will be a memorable event."
